Cluster Optimization vs. Auto Channel

The Auto-channel means that a Wi-Fi router selects channels automatically based on the vendor’s algorithms. In this case, only a single device is considered and this can increase interference for the whole system.

DOCSIS FBC Impairment Algorithms - Adjacency

There are many different Full Band Capture (FBC) impairments, one of the interesting impairments is adjacency because it is often so pronounced on the spectrum. The figures below shows a small adjacency: The channels suddenly jump slightly in their dB level.
